技术文摘
Vue助力深度学习统计图表的实现方法
Vue助力深度学习统计图表的实现方法
在深度学习领域,统计图表对于数据的可视化呈现至关重要,而Vue作为一款轻量级的JavaScript框架,能为其实现提供强大助力。
Vue的响应式原理是实现动态统计图表的基础。通过双向数据绑定,当深度学习模型的数据发生变化时,Vue能够自动更新与之绑定的图表元素,无需开发者手动干预。这一特性极大地提高了开发效率,确保图表始终准确反映最新的数据状态。
在选择图表库时,Vue有众多优秀的选择。例如ECharts,它提供了丰富多样的图表类型,从简单的柱状图、折线图到复杂的地理图、桑基图等,应有尽有。只需简单配置,就能在Vue项目中引入ECharts并定制出符合深度学习需求的图表。以展示模型训练过程中的损失函数变化为例,使用折线图可以清晰地呈现损失值随训练轮数的下降趋势,帮助开发者及时调整模型参数。
Vue的组件化开发模式也为统计图表的实现带来便利。可以将图表封装成独立的组件,每个组件负责特定类型图表的展示逻辑。这样不仅提高了代码的复用性,还便于后期的维护和扩展。当需要在多个页面展示相似的统计图表时,直接引用组件即可,无需重复编写代码。
在处理大规模深度学习数据时,性能优化是关键。Vue通过虚拟DOM技术,有效减少了DOM操作的次数,提高了图表渲染的速度。合理使用数据分页、抽样等策略,避免一次性加载过多数据导致页面卡顿。
Vue生态系统中的路由管理和状态管理工具也能与统计图表实现良好结合。利用Vue Router可以实现不同图表页面之间的平滑切换,而Vuex则能方便地管理图表所需的数据状态,确保数据在整个应用中的一致性。
借助Vue的诸多特性,能够高效、灵活地实现深度学习所需的统计图表,为数据分析和模型评估提供直观、准确的可视化支持,推动深度学习项目的顺利开展。
- 前端热敏纸小票打印出现乱码的解决方法
- 计算机编程中pattern的含义
- Rollup打包时正确配置Babel转译node_modules中指定模块(如@xyflow)代码的方法
- 扁平化数组转树形结构的方法
- Rollup打包时Babel转译node_modules代码失败的解决方法
- 即时设计实现复制透明PNG图片且保留透明效果的方法
- JavaScript 如何高效实现扁平数组到树形结构的转换
- JavaScript splice方法删除数组元素后为何返回的不是修改后的数组
- 即时设计实现PNG图片透明复制的方法
- JavaScript向数组末尾添加元素、去重并逆序返回最后指定个数元素的方法
- 用递归算法依据末节点值回溯拼接树形数据中从末节点到根节点的标签值的方法
- 编程中的Pattern究竟该怎么翻译
- 同步NPM包于多个注册表之间
- Nodejs 中 Stripe 订阅集成的终极指南
- 前端导出Excel表格时样式定制及单元格编辑难题的解决方法